Tips

To enhance learning further through playing Connect 4, encourage the student to try different strategies, analyze their opponents' moves, and experiment with new tactics. Encouraging the student to play against people with varying skill levels can also provide new challenges and insights. Setting up tournaments or creating variations of the game can add excitement and complexity to the gameplay, fostering continuous learning and growth.
